Navigating the Mouse: A Guide to Basic Computer Maneuvering
Wiki Article
Embark on your computer journey with confidence by learning the fundamentals of mouse control. This essential tool enables you to manipulate your digital world with ease. Start by understanding the basic functions: clicking, double-clicking, scrolling, and dragging.
- Clicking a mouse button once is used to choose items or execute actions.
- Double-clicking provides more detailed interaction, often launching files or applications.
- Scrolling up and down lets you browse through documents or web pages vertically.
- Dragging involves holding down the mouse button and sliding it across the surface, allowing you to transfer items within your digital environment.
Practice these fundamental mouse skills regularly to refine your computer navigation proficiency.

Email Essentials: Communicating Effectively Online
In today's rapidly evolving world, email remains a cornerstone of professional and everyday communication. Crafting concise emails is essential for {buildingnetworks, conveying information effectively, and achieving your goals. A well-structured email communicates professionalism, clarity, and respect.
When composing an email, it's crucial to factor in your audience. Tailor your tone and language accordingly to guarantee optimal impact. Leverage a professional subject line that accurately reflects the email's content. This helps individuals quickly understand the purpose of your message and lead to them reading it.
Remember to edit your emails carefully for any grammatical errors or typos. A polished email conveys attention to detail and boosts the likelihood of a positive response. Additionally, be mindful of email etiquette, such as using appropriate greetings and closings, responding messages in a timely manner, and avoiding excessive use of exclamation points or informal language in professional contexts.
Exploring the Web with Ease
Ready to dive into the vast and exciting world of the internet? Understanding web browsing basics is your key to unlocking its endless possibilities. First, let's explore the essential tools you'll need: a web browser, like Chrome, Firefox, or Safari, and an internet connection. Once you have these in place, you can begin your journey by entering web locations into the address bar.
- Effortlessly type the address and press Enter to be transported to that specific website.
- Use the back button to revert to your previous page, and the forward button to proceed where you left off.
- Most browsers offer a home button that takes you back to your preferred homepage.
Bookmark websites you use often for quick and easy access later. Don't be afraid to explore new content, search information, and interact with the online world. Remember, practice makes perfect!
